A Graduate Certificate in Intercultural Adaptation Techniques equips professionals with the crucial skills needed to navigate diverse cultural environments effectively. The program focuses on developing practical strategies for successful cross-cultural communication and collaboration.
Learning outcomes include enhanced understanding of cultural dimensions, improved intercultural communication proficiency, and the ability to design and implement culturally sensitive interventions. Graduates gain expertise in conflict resolution, negotiation, and team building within diverse contexts. This directly translates to improved global leadership capabilities.
The duration of the Graduate Certificate in Intercultural Adaptation Techniques typically ranges from 6 to 12 months, depending on the institution and the student's chosen course load. Flexible online options are often available, catering to working professionals.
This certificate holds significant industry relevance across numerous sectors. From international business and development to education and healthcare, the ability to adapt to and work effectively within diverse cultural settings is increasingly valuable. Graduates find employment opportunities in multinational corporations, NGOs, government agencies, and educational institutions worldwide. The program cultivates essential skills in global citizenship and cross-cultural understanding.
The program's curriculum often incorporates case studies, simulations, and real-world projects, fostering practical application of learned intercultural communication and sensitivity theories. This ensures graduates are well-prepared for immediate impact in their chosen fields, demonstrating strong intercultural competence.
